WINNER : PARTNERSHIP WORKING - NO USE EMPTY
An initiative to bring long-term empty properties in Kent back into use that has inspired similar action in other areas of the country was a clear cut winner for those judging the partnership working accolade.
The judges praised the team for getting the partnership working across different levels of government and with other agencies and local landowners. "It's rare to be able to do this because it can be very difficult to get a coordinated view across a number of authorities", says Andy Karski, one of the judges and principal at Tibbalds Planning and Urban Desin.
